Was just in my acct and was just looking around and decided to check my computers and at the bottom of the info on my computers it has a MERGE COMPUTER link, what does that do.......

Through attaching/detaching and a few other variables, you can generate another host ID for the same computer. The merge feature will attempt to combine identical hosts to a single ID. (the "merged" host will always have the most recently created host ID)
